Crawl Space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in a contained area Yes No DIY methods can be effective for small spills.
Visible mold and mildew growth No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ely remove mold and mildew.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Professional help is necessary to quickly and safely address the issue.
High humidity levels in the crawl space No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and effectively address humidity issues.
Water stains and dampness in the crawl space No Yes Professional help is necessary to identify and address the source of the issue.
Unpleasant air quality in the crawl space No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and effectively address air quality issues.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Pahokee, FL

The cost of crawl space water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pahokee, FL. Here are some estimated price ranges for common crawl space water ext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of the issue and size of the aff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area and equipment needed
Cleanup and Disinfection $100 – $500 Size of the affected area and equipment needed
Final Inspection and Report $50 – $200 Severity of the issue and size of the affected area
